• Home
  • History
  • Annotate
  • Raw
  • Download
  • only in /netgear-R7000-V1.0.7.12_1.2.5/components/opensource/linux/linux-2.6.36/drivers/media/dvb/frontends/

Lines Matching defs:config

51 	struct drx397xD_config config;
195 .addr = s->config.demod_address,
246 .addr = s->config.demod_address,
251 .addr = s->config.demod_address,
273 .addr = s->config.demod_address,
395 WR16(s, 0x420034, s->config.w50); /* code 4, log 4 */
396 WR16(s, 0x420035, s->config.w52); /* code 15, log 9 */
397 WR16(s, 0x420036, s->config.demod_address << 1);
398 WR16(s, 0x420037, s->config.w56); /* code (set_i2c ?? initX 1 ), log 1 */
400 if ((s->config.w56 & 8) == 0)
493 s->config.w9C &= ~2;
494 EXIT_RC(WR16(s, 0x0c20015, s->config.w9C));
503 s->config.w9C &= ~2;
504 EXIT_RC(WR16(s, 0x0c20015, s->config.w9C));
514 s->config.w9C |= 2;
515 EXIT_RC(WR16(s, 0x0c20015, s->config.w9C));
541 if (s->config.d60 != 2)
561 if (s->config.d5C == 0) {
564 s->config.d5C = 1;
567 if (s->config.d5C != 1)
599 clk_limit = s->config.f_osc * MAX_CLOCK_DRIFT / 1000;
601 if (clk - s->config.f_osc * 1000 + clk_limit <= 2 * clk_limit) {
604 s->config.f_osc * 1000, clk - s->config.f_osc * 1000);
618 si = s->config.wA0;
619 if (s->config.w98 == 0) {
626 if (s->config.w9A == 0)
652 pr_debug("%s %d\n", __func__, s->config.d60);
654 if (s->config.d60 != 2)
660 s->config.d60 = 1;
707 rc = SetCfgIfAgc(s, &s->config.ifagc);
711 rc = SetCfgRfAgc(s, &s->config.rfagc);
953 if (s->config.s20d24 == 1) {
1038 ebx = div64_u64(((u64) (s->config.f_if + df_tuner) << 28) +
1072 s->config.d60 = 2;
1089 s->config.rfagc.d00 = 2; /* 0x7c */
1090 s->config.rfagc.w04 = 0;
1091 s->config.rfagc.w06 = 0x3ff;
1093 s->config.ifagc.d00 = 0; /* 0x68 */
1094 s->config.ifagc.w04 = 0;
1095 s->config.ifagc.w06 = 140;
1096 s->config.ifagc.w08 = 0;
1097 s->config.ifagc.w0A = 0x3ff;
1098 s->config.ifagc.w0C = 0x388;
1101 s->config.ss76 = 820;
1102 s->config.ss78 = 2200;
1103 s->config.ss7A = 150;
1106 s->config.w50 = 4;
1107 s->config.w52 = 9;
1109 s->config.f_if = 42800000; /* d14: intermediate frequency [Hz] */
1110 s->config.f_osc = 48000; /* s66 : oscillator frequency [kHz] */
1111 s->config.w92 = 12000;
1113 s->config.w9C = 0x000e;
1114 s->config.w9E = 0x0000;
1117 s->config.wA0 = 4;
1118 s->config.w98 = 1;
1119 s->config.w9A = 1;
1171 if (s->config.w92 > 20000 || s->config.w92 % 4000) {
1183 rc = WR16(s, 0x2410012, s->config.w92 / 4000);
1195 s->f_osc = s->config.f_osc * 1000; /* initial estimator */
1197 s->config.w56 = 1;
1229 s->config.w9C = 0x0e;
1231 s->config.w9C = 0;
1272 rc = WR16(s, 0x0C20013, s->config.w9E);
1275 rc = WR16(s, 0x0C20015, s->config.w9C);
1301 rc = SetCfgIfAgc(s, &s->config.ifagc);
1305 rc = SetCfgRfAgc(s, &s->config.rfagc);
1313 s->config.d5C = 0;
1314 s->config.d60 = 1;
1315 s->config.d48 = 1;
1332 s->config.s20d24 = 1;
1386 if (s->config.ifagc.d00 == 2) {
1477 struct dvb_frontend *drx397xD_attach(const struct drx397xD_config *config,
1489 memcpy(&state->config, config, sizeof(struct drx397xD_config));